Dell Precision 7780 How to activate the EGPU during Boot Process
Dear Support,
I need to set up the Dell 7780 in the Boot Process with the EGPU attached to start up.
I have an External Graphic Card from Blackmagic with AMD Vega 56 connected via Thunderbolt.
The F8 Button is not working except within the Windows 11 function.
Keep the LID Closed is not working to boot up with EGPU Support.
I could not find any hint in the BIOS to make sure the Boot process is supported in EGPU.
Please advise how I can get the EGPU switched on as of booting the Laptop.

To get switched in BIOS mode the Screen from Laptop to an external Monitor via DP / HDMI, you need to switch off the Intel Virtualization in BIOS completely off.
But still the Problem is in place to get the Thunderbolt connected external eGPU activated.
